Good-bye to the garden

I just said good-bye to the vegetable garden of 2013, taking advantage of this warm, breezy afternoon to pull up the dead plants and spread straw. The sunflowers were long gone and the zinnias, celosia, salvia, gomphrena and pumpkins got hit by the frost a week or so ago. The snapdragons are hanging in there and I actually might get a few more bouquets. Not bad for the end of October!
My next chore is to dig up and divide the Peruvian daffodils; they have lovely and fragrant flowers, but the bulbs seem to multiply each season like Bartholomew Cubbins' hats.
There are already amaryllis bulb kits being sold in the grocery stores. Despite their low price, I always have great luck with them.
